NBA Playoffs: French Bigs Clash in Western Conference Semifinals

The NBA playoffs heat up as the Minnesota Timberwolves and San Antonio Spurs gear up for a thrilling second-round series. This matchup features a unique twist: a battle between French big men, Rudy Gobert and Victor Wembanyama. Get ready for an intense showdown!

Timberwolves' Resilience vs. Spurs' Depth

The Timberwolves' journey to the semifinals has been nothing short of remarkable. Despite losing key players Anthony Edwards and Donte DiVincenzo, they displayed incredible heart and determination. Their playoff experience and resilience cannot be understated, having reached the second round for the third consecutive year. This team knows how to rise to the occasion when it matters most.

On the other hand, the Spurs are a force to be reckoned with. They possess an impressive depth of creation, which often gets overshadowed by Wembanyama's stardom. Players like De'Aaron Fox, Steph Castle, and Dylan Harper have consistently stepped up, showcasing the team's ability to win in various ways. When Wembanyama doesn't dominate, the Spurs' off-ball movement and speed become even more lethal.

Key Matchups and Strategies

The series will likely hinge on several crucial factors. First, the health of the Timberwolves' players is a major concern. Ayo Dosunmu's emergence as a scoring threat adds a new dimension to their offense, but his calf injury could impact their chances. The Spurs' tenacious defense will aim to exploit any weaknesses in the Timberwolves' depleted backcourt.

For the Spurs, managing Wembanyama's health is essential, but they've proven they can win without him. The real challenge lies in maintaining their shooting and ball movement against a stronger opponent. The Timberwolves' defense, led by Gobert, will make every possession a battle.

Long-Term Playoff Outlook

Looking ahead, the Spurs are emerging as serious championship contenders. They have passed every test thus far, with Wembanyama leading the charge. The team's balance and the young players' resilience under pressure make them a force to be reckoned with.

However, the Timberwolves face an uphill battle. While their defense is impressive, the loss of key players may hinder their offensive capabilities. The Spurs' depth and health advantage could prove decisive in this series and beyond.

Series Prediction

As for the series prediction, it's a tough call. If the Timberwolves were at full strength, I'd favor them due to their playoff experience and regular-season success against the Spurs. However, with their current injury woes, I predict the Spurs will prevail. The series could go the distance, but the Spurs' depth and talent should see them through, likely in six or seven games.
